SEGMENT INFORMATION
SEGMENT INFORMATION
We provide electronic design and test instruments and systems and related software, software design tools, and related services that are used in the design, development, manufacture, installation, deployment and operation of electronics equipment. Related services include start-up assistance, instrument productivity and application services and instrument calibration and repair. Additionally, we provide test, security and visibility solutions that validate, secure and optimize networks and applications from engineering concept to live deployment. We also offer customization, consulting and optimization services throughout the customer's product life cycle.
In 2019 we completed an organizational change to align our services business with our customer-solutions-oriented, go-to-market strategy as reflected by our Keysight Leadership Model ("KLM"). This change was made to fully reflect our services delivery within the markets served and further enable the growth of our services solutions portfolio. Prior period segment results were revised to conform to the presentation. As a result, Keysight has three segments: Communications Solutions Group, Electronic Industrial Solutions Group and Ixia Solutions Group. The organizational structure continues to include centralized enterprise functions that provide support across the groups.
To more effectively and efficiently address customer solution needs across the communications ecosystem as the network transforms, in the first quarter of fiscal 2020, we completed an organizational change to manage our Ixia Solutions Group within our Communications Solutions Group. We believe this realignment will create improved go-to-market and product development alignment, as well as accelerate solution synergies in 5G as this new technology is deployed globally. As a result, beginning with our first quarter of fiscal 2020, we will have two reportable operating segments, Communications Solutions Group (“CSG”) and Electronic Industrial Solutions Group (“EISG”).
Our operating segments were determined based primarily on how the chief operating decision maker views and evaluates our operations. Segment operating results are regularly reviewed by the chief operating decision maker to make decisions about resources to be allocated to each segment and to assess performance. Other factors, including market separation and customer specific applications, go-to-market channels, products and services and manufacturing are considered in determining the formation of these operating segments.
Descriptions of our three reportable segments are as follows:
The Communications Solutions Group serves customers spanning the worldwide commercial communications and aerospace, defense and government end markets. The group provides electronic design and test software, instruments, systems and related services used in the simulation, design, validation, manufacturing, installation and optimization of electronic equipment.
The Electronic Industrial Solutions Group provides test and measurement solutions and related services across a broad set of electronic industrial end markets, focusing on high-value applications in the automotive and energy industry and measurement solutions for consumer electronics, education, general electronics design and manufacturing, and semiconductor design and manufacturing. The group provides electronic design and test software, instruments and systems and related services used in the simulation, design, validation, manufacturing, installation and optimization of electronic equipment.
The Ixia Solutions Group helps customers design, validate and optimize the performance and security resilience of their networks and associated components and applications. Network test, network visibility and security solutions help organizations and their customers strengthen their physical and virtual networks. The group’s solutions consist of software applications and services, including warranty and maintenance offerings, and high-performance hardware platforms.
A significant portion of the segments' expenses arise from shared services and infrastructure that we have historically provided to the segments in order to realize economies of scale and to efficiently use resources. These expenses, collectively called corporate charges, include legal, accounting, real estate, insurance services, information technology services, treasury and other corporate infrastructure expenses. Charges are allocated to the segments, and the allocations have been determined on a basis that we considered to be a reasonable reflection of the utilization of services provided to or benefits received by the segments.
The following tables reflect the results of our reportable segments under our management reporting system. These results are not necessarily in conformity with GAAP. The performance of each segment is measured based on several metrics, including income from operations. These results are used, in part, by the chief operating decision maker in evaluating the performance of, and in allocating resources to, each of the segments.
The profitability of each of the segments is measured after excluding share-based compensation expense, restructuring and related costs, amortization of acquisition-related balances, acquisition and integration costs, acquisition-related compensation expense, separation and related costs, pension curtailment and settlement loss (gain), northern California wildfire-related costs, goodwill impairment, legal settlement, gain on divestitures, interest income, interest expense and other items as noted in the reconciliations below.

Major customers.  No customer represented 10 percent or more of our total net revenue in 2019, 2018 or 2017.
